'Jacqueline' rose Description
'Jacqueline (hybrid tea, Hill 1961)' rose photo
Photo courtesy of Dianne's Southwest Idaho Rose Garden
HMF Ratings:
5 favorite votes.  
ARS:
Hybrid Tea.
Origin:
Bred by Joseph H. Hill (United States, 1961).
Class:
Hybrid Tea.  
Bloom:
Red.  Moderate fragrance.  30 petals.  Average diameter 4.25".  Large, full (26-40 petals), high-centered bloom form.  Blooms in flushes throughout the season.  Pointed buds.  
Habit:
Well-branched.  Glossy foliage.  
Growing:
USDA zone 6b through 9b (default).  
Patents:
United States - Patent No: PP 2,183  on  16 Oct 1962   VIEW USPTO PATENT
Notes:
color: Turkey Red blooms
